How much do senior inventory planner j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ior inventory planner in Atlanta, GA is $80,818.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$66,200.00 and $93,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ior inventory planner?

A Senior Inventory Planner requires strong analytical and forecasting skills, a background in supply chain management or a related field, and experience in inventory planning. Familiarity with ERP systems (such as SAP or Oracle), advanced Excel skills, and certifications like APICS CPIM are often expected. Attention to detail, effective communication, and the ability to collaborate cross-functionally help set top performers apart. These qualifications are critical for optimizing stock levels, supporting business objectives, and ensuring smooth operations.

What does a senior inventory planner do?

A Senior Inventory Planner is responsible for managing inventory levels, analyzing demand forecasts, and ensuring product availability while minimizing excess stock. They collaborate with supply chain, purchasing, and sales teams to optimize stock levels and improve efficiency. Their role involves using data analysis, inventory management systems, and strategic planning to meet business goals and customer demand. Additionally, they may develop inventory policies, identify trends, and implement process improvements to enhance supply chain performance.

Job description

Job Summary

Responsible for managing and analyzing inventory levels for the business unit to ensure optimum levels and maximizing fill rate performance. Mentor junior team members.

Major Tasks, Responsibilities, and Key Accountabilities

  • Leverages SAP and other systems to execute "tactical inventory control with a goal to maintain excellent customer service while efficiently managing inventory.
  • Partners with Inventory Analytics and Merchandising to proactively identify and address fill rate issues and excess inventory.
  • Utilizes and monitors exception reports and daily analytics for key business metrics.
  • Develops and executes strategy for SKU transitions seasonal trends, and customer-specific positions.
  • Works to align inventory system controls (EOQ, min/max, safety stock, velocity rankings) with business objectives. Analyzes and communicates impact of proposed changes.
  • Manages supplier relations and partners with supplier to address fill rate, lead time, damaged in-transit issues and supplier return.
  • Drives additional process improvement initiatives to introduce streamlined strategies across business network.
  • Develops and demonstrates best practice techniques to guide junior associates

Nature and Scope

  • Identifies key barriers/core problems and applies problem solving skills in order to deal creatively with complex situations. Troubleshoots and resolves complex problems. Makes decisions under conditions of uncertainty, sometimes with incomplete information, that produce effective end results.
  • Independently performs assignments with instruction limited to the expected results. Determines and develops an approach to solutions. Receives technical guidance only on unusual or complex problems or issues.
  • May oversee the completion of projects and assignments, including planning, assigning, monitoring and reviewing progress and accuracy of work, evaluating results, etc. Contributes to employees' professional development but does not have hiring or firing authority.

Work Environment

  • Located in a comfortable indoor area. Any unpleasant conditions would be infrequent and not objectionable.
  • Most of the time is spent sitting in the same position or standing/walking and/or there is some requirement to lift or handle material or equipment of moderate weight (8-20 pounds).
  • Typically requires overnight travel less than 10% of the time.

Education and Experience

  • Typically requires BS/BA in a related discipline. Generally 5-8 years of experience in a related field OR MS/MA and generally 3-5 years of experience in a related field. Certification is required in some areas.
